As you make your way around the Internet, you will find lots of web sites with typos (misspelled words). As amusing as this might be, it also communicates a certain lack of professionalism by the owner of the web site. Misspelled words can also lead to lack of understanding or comprehension by the visitor to the site. In the most serious of cases this can even lead to legal issues.

FRSWebSpell™ seeks to remedy this situation. It identifies words not found in the dictionary. It is then up to you to determine whether an unrecognized word is spelled correctly and simply not found in the dictionary, or if the word is truly misspelled. You can ignore the word, add it to your custom dictionary, or correct it. FRSWebSpell offers suggestions for misspelled words, if available.

FRSWebSpell comes with a standard U.S. English dictionary that contains well over 91,000 words. The application will automatically download the latest U.S. English dictionary from the Fourth Ray Software server when a new version is available.

If FRSWebSpell identifies a word not found in the standard U.S. English dictionary and you decide that the word is spelled correctly, you can add it to a custom dictionary. This is a dictionary that you can update as you please. A full-featured and easy-to-use editor for the dictionary is built right into the application. When the word is added to your custom dictionary, FRSWebSpell will, from then on, recognize the word as valid.

Many people use Microsoft® Word® as their document editor. Word® has its own custom dictionaries. If you use MS Word to perform spell checking of your office documents, you will most likely have collected a list of words in MS Word's custom dictionary. FRSWebSpell recognizes MS Word's custom dictionaries. At your discretion, you can tell FRSWebSpell to use the MS Word custom dictionary. Any number of custom MS Word dictionaries are supported. And, yes, you can modify your MS Word custom dictionaries directly from within FRSWebSpell also!

FRSWebSpell now also supports the Mozilla Thunderbird custom dictionary, which you might have updated while composing e-mails, if you use that application.

You can select which dictionaries to use for each individual web site project. How flexible is that! Because of custom dictionaries, non-English dictionaries are indirectly supported as well.

FRSWebSpell can spell check any web site you maintain. The product is intended for webmasters, and so it assumes that you have a copy of your web site's HTML files on your computer or on a computer connected to your local network. FRSWebSpell does not spell check web sites directly on the Web. This is by design. You must have access to the files on your computer. You can set up as many web site projects as you need within FRSWebSpell. If you maintain more than one web site, you can quickly spell check them all. Both public Internet and private Intranet web sites can be spell checked.

Only words visible to a web page's visitor are spell checked. FRSWebSpell™ ignores words found in HTML comments, HTML tags, style blocks, etc.

FRSWebSpell starts spell checking immediately after you have set up your web site project. Any unrecognized words are shown in the main window. If you have previously set up the project, when FRSWebSpell starts, it will start spell checking. This means that you can set up FRSWebSpell to be scheduled by the Windows Operating System to run at a certain day and time, so that it is done by the time you are ready to look at the results.

You can correct typos directly from within FRSWebSpell. It makes temporary back-up copies of the affected files, so that you can be confident to reverse any changes you have made from within FRSWebSpell. If you prefer to make the change yourself, FRSWebSpell provides the means to quickly launch a selected HTML file into your default web page editor. You can also preview the file in your web browser.

If you leave FRSWebSpell up while you modify your web pages locally, it will automatically spell check the files as soon as they are saved to disk.

FRSWebSpell can analyze all the popular HTML-based file formats, such as htm, html, shtml, php, asp, jsp, etc.
